Page 2 of 2

Posted: Thu 3. May 2007, 16:11
by kukki
Danke für die Hinweise in diesem Thread, ich konnte mit dem Eingrif /Upgrade von 1.2.6 auf 1.3.3 mit

Code: Select all

ALTER TABLE `phpwcms_articlecontent` ADD `acontent_created` TIMESTAMP NOT NULL DEFAULT '0000-00-00 00:00:00' AFTER `acontent_uid` ;
erst einmal meine Datenbank wieder zum Laufen bringen. Der oben geschilderte Feher ist behoben. Allerdings frage ich mich, wer wohl hier nicht aufgepasst hat. Ich denke, dass das Upgrade noch nicht ganz einwandfrei funktioniert, nur eine Neuinstallation geht ohne Probleme ab! :shock:

Posted: Mon 7. May 2007, 07:33
by Oliver Georgi
man sollte schon alle Updateschritte durchführen

Upgrade.php -> Menü: 15__1.2.7-DEV_to_1.2.9.sql

Oliver

Posted: Thu 10. May 2007, 22:47
by SliPkNoT
Hallo,


ich bin auch auf das Problem nach dem Update auf 1.3.3 gestoßen, und wenn ich das 15__1.2.7-DEV_to_1.2.9.sql update mache kommt folgende fehlermeldung?

ERROR: Incorrect table definition; there can be only one TIMESTAMP column with CURRENT_TIMESTAMP in DEFAULT or ON UPDATE clause -> ALTER TABLE `phpwcms_articlecontent` ADD `acontent_created` TIMESTAMP NOT NULL AFTER `acontent_uid`;


irgend jemand ne idee woher die kommen kann?

DANKE!

Posted: Fri 11. May 2007, 00:14
by Oliver Georgi
liegt an einer alten MySQL Version.

Nutze folgende Query:
ALTER TABLE `phpwcms_articlecontent` ADD `acontent_created` TIMESTAMP NOT NULL AFTER `acontent_uid` ;
Oliver

Posted: Fri 11. May 2007, 09:20
by flip-flop
Bei einigen DB-Versionen darf scheinbar keine Collation angegeben werden beim Einfügen von
ALTER TABLE `phpwcms_articlecontent` ADD `acontent_created` TIMESTAMP NOT NULL AFTER `acontent_uid` ;
Sonst kommt besagter Fehler auch während des Setups, der gerne überlesen wird.
Danach können keine Artikel angelegt werden.

Wenn also die Automatik im Setup nicht funktioniert, kann der Eintrag in phpMyAdmin angelegt werden ohne eine Collation-Auswahl.

Knut

Posted: Fri 11. May 2007, 12:46
by SliPkNoT
danke schon mal für die antworten.

wie meinst du das mit query nutzen?


über phpmyadmin die db umschreiben?!? sry bin noch unerfahren! oder wäre es ratsam wenn möglich die mysql version upzudaten?

wie kann ich dann diesen eintrag in phpmyadmin anlegen? so dass ich wieder artiel erstellen kann?

Posted: Fri 11. May 2007, 13:34
by flip-flop
Eintrag anlegen:

- DB mit phpMyAdmin offnen
- DB aktivieren (Auf die DB klicken in der Auswahl, wenn vorhanden).
- In das Feld SQL den oben beschriebenen Eintrag hineinkopieren
- Keine Collation auswählen !!!!!!
- Ok

Wenn nun keine Fehlermeldung auftaucht hat es geklappt.

Knut

Posted: Fri 11. May 2007, 20:29
by SliPkNoT
super, DANKE hat geklappt!!


DANKE!!

bin jetzt weider einen kleine schritt richtung online vorangekommen^^

das einzige was ich noch nicht hinbekommen habe, ist dass er die bilder nicht mehr zentriert darstellt wenn ich sie vergrößern möchte?!?

Posted: Fri 11. May 2007, 21:00
by Jensensen
SliPkNoT wrote:das einzige was ich noch nicht hinbekommen habe, ist dass er die bilder nicht mehr zentriert darstellt wenn ich sie vergrößern möchte?!?
diese pop-ups werden seit v1.29 [1.3?] nicht mehr zentriert.

hast du schon die lightbox variante [>v1.3.2] gecheckt??

kannste die centered pop ups vergessen....

Posted: Tue 10. Jul 2007, 22:59
by rmagg
habe auch etliche Fehlem beim Upgrade.

Die von Kukki vorgeschlagene Loesung funktioniert bei mir, aber nicht die von Oli. Die Geschichte von Flip Flop mit "Collation" versehe nicht, bzw, kriege ich nicht hin.

Roland